# §790.59. Failure to comply with a test rule.

- (a) Persons who notified EPA of their intent to conduct a test required in a test rule in [part 799](/cfr/40/part799.md) of this chapter and who fail to conduct the test in accordance with the test standards and schedules adopted in the test rule, or as modified in accordance with [§ 790.55](/cfr/40/790.55.md), will be in violation of the rule.
- (b) Any person who fails or refuses to comply with any aspect of this part or a test rule under [part 799](/cfr/40/part799.md) of this chapter is in violation of [section 15](/cfr/40/15.md) of the Act. EPA will treat violations of the Good Laboratory Practice standards as indicated in [§ 792.17](/cfr/40/792.17.md) of this chapter.
- (c) Persons who fail to pay the requisite fee as specified in [§ 700.45(c)](/cfr/40/700.45.md?p=c) of this chapter will be in violation of the rule.
